People don't realize how difficult it is to launch a bike without launch control, and that guy did it damn fkn good! Usually riders drops the clutch and then the engine boggs down and are left in low rpm, which takes a while to get back to the hihger rpm to get all the power. But by then the cars are already gone. But this guy was slipping the clutch at high rpm to use the max amount of torque and hp he can till the speed of the bike matches the speed of the gearbox. That's how you recognize a great biker. Just shows too even with electric insta torque at an electric cars ideal torque speed 50mph that an R1 can still quickly catch and spank it😂 BTW thats not even the quickest R1 there are three models this shape that can beat it GYTR and Pro and another one that costs about the price of these cars and the fastest quarter mile R1 of all is still the 2004-2007 5VY model that was 186bhp and 180kg. Them R1s were nasty fast over a quarter they would regularly put in 9.8s and all this even on 2005 era tyres. The 5VY models 2nd and 3rd gear performance must still be one of the fastest "turn of speed" of any production machine.
